Diskaroo
A treemap visualizer with collector tray and smart filters.
+ Diskaroo: 优点
- Treemap plus collector tray mirrors the best cleanup flows
- Smart filters and duplicate detection in Pro
- Runs on all three desktop platforms
- Diskaroo: 缺点
- Pro unlock costs more than several native Mac rivals
- Cross-platform UI rather than native SwiftUI feel
- Newer brand with limited independent reviews

DissectMac
A fast local treemap with uninstaller and live monitoring.
+ DissectMac: 优点
- Fast local treemaps with live disk monitoring
- Bundled uninstaller covers app leftovers
- Free tier for basic analysis
- DissectMac: 缺点
- Treemap-only visualization; no sunburst or list-first mode
- Monitoring features overlap with free macOS tools
- Young product with a thin review record
